Photosynthesis: Conversion of Light Energy to Chemical Energy
Introduction to Photosynthesis
Photosynthesis is a remarkable biochemical process through which green plants, algae, and certain bacteria convert light energy into chemical energy stored in glucose, a form of carbohydrate. This process is not only fundamental to the survival of autotrophic organisms but also essential for life on Earth, since it forms the basis of the food chain and contributes to the atmospheric oxygen we breathe.
